加密货币密码计算详解:解析密码学原理与应用

            发布时间:2024-09-14 04:57:30

            随着加密货币的广泛应用和技术的迅速发展,密码学在其中扮演了极其重要的角色。本文将深入探讨加密货币密码的计算原理,具体包括密码学的基础知识、加密货币交易的运作方式、密码的生成与验证过程,以及安全与隐私保护的机制。此外,还将对一些常见问题进行详细解答,帮助读者更好地理解这一复杂的领域。

            一、密码学基础知识

            密码学是一门研究如何通过数学和计算机科学来保护信息安全的学科。在加密货币中,密码学主要用于提供数据的保密性、完整性和不可抵赖性。主要的密码学技术包括对称加密、非对称加密和哈希函数等。

            1. 对称加密:在对称加密中,发送者和接收者共享同一把密钥。加密和解密过程使用相同的密钥。这种方法的优点是速度快,但问题在于密钥的分发和管理。常见的算法包括AES(高级加密标准)。

            2. 非对称加密:非对称加密使用一对密钥,公钥和私钥。公钥用于加密,私钥用于解密。即使公钥被公开,也难以推算出私钥,因此这种方法在加密货币中尤其重要。RSA和椭圆曲线加密(ECDSA)是较为常用的非对称加密算法。

            3. 哈希函数:哈希函数是一种将任意长度的数据映射到固定长度输出的函数,且具有单向性和抗碰撞性。常见的哈希算法如SHA-256和RIPEMD-160。在区块链中,哈希函数用于确保数据的完整性,使其不可篡改。

            二、加密货币的交易机制

            加密货币交易的基本机制可以分为几个步骤:用户请求交易、网络验证、区块生成、交易记录和维护账本。通过这些步骤,加密货币得以安全地进行转移。

            1. 用户请求交易:用户通过钱包软件发起加密货币的转账。这一请求包含发送者、接收者的地址,以及转账金额。此请求会被软件生成一个数字签名,确保请求的合法性。

            2. 网络验证:交易请求被发送到加密货币的网络中,节点(矿工)将对交易进行验证,确保发送者的账户余额足够,并验证交易的数字签名。

            3. 区块生成:经过验证的交易将被打包到区块中。矿工通过竞争计算复杂的数学问题来生成新的区块,这一过程称为“挖矿”。一旦完成,区块将被添加到区块链中,并向网络广播。

            4. 交易记录与账本维护:每一笔交易都会记录在区块链上形成永久记录。所有节点保留这个账本,这样即使某一个节点失效,其他节点仍能维护数据的完整性和可用性。

            三、加密货币密码的生成与验证

            加密货币交易的安全性依赖于密码的生成与验证。这一过程通常涉及公私钥的生成,以及数字签名的使用。

            1. 公私钥对的生成:每个用户在钱包软件中生成一对公私钥。私钥由用户保管,公钥可以公开。用户的加密货币地址是通过对公钥进行哈希运算生成的。

            2. 数字签名的使用:在发起交易时,用户使用其私钥对交易信息进行签名。数字签名可以验证交易的发起者确实是拥有该地址的用户。此外,数字签名还提供了交易不可抵赖性,确保发送者不能否认自己的交易。

            3. 验证过程:其他节点在验证交易时,会使用公钥对数字签名进行验证,以确保交易的合法性。这使得中介介入的必要性降低,提升了交易的效率与安全性。

            四、安全与隐私保护机制

            加密货币的安全性与隐私保护是其吸引用户的重要因素。通过多种技术手段,用户的资金与信息得以保护。

            1. 密钥管理:用户需要妥善管理和保护个人私钥。若私钥被第三方获得,用户的资金可能面临风险。钱包软件通常会提供备份和加密选项,确保用户可以安全地存储私钥。

            2. 交易匿名性:一些加密货币特别注重用户的隐私。通过技术手段,如环签名和零知识证明,用户可以在进行交易时保持匿名,防止资金流向被追踪。

            3. 防止双重消费:区块链技术凭借其分散性质,确保了一笔交易只能被记录一次,避免了双重消费的问题。每个节点都保存着完整的交易记录,任何试图伪造交易的尝试都会因为不匹配而被拒绝。

            相关问题解答

            1. 如何确保加密货币交易的安全性?

            确保加密货币交易的安全性是每个用户必须关注的问题。以下几点可以有效增强交易安全性:

            1. 使用强密码:选择复杂而不易猜测的密码,并定期更新。

            2. 开启双重认证:利用双重认证功能提供额外的安全层,以防止未经授权的访问。

            3. 保持软件更新:定期更新钱包软件和相关工具,确保使用最新的安全特性。

            4. 使用冷钱包:对持有的加密货币进行冷存储,避免在线钱包受到黑客攻击。

            5. 验证接收地址:在进行交易前,务必核实接收地址,避免因钓鱼攻击而导致资金丢失。

            2. 加密货币的交易速度受什么影响?

            加密货币的交易速度不仅受各种技术因素影响,也与网络的拥堵情况和选用的加密货币类型有关。

            1. 网络拥堵:交易量激增会导致网络拥堵,从而延长交易确认时间。提高交易手续费可以加快确认速度。

            2. 区块时间:不同加密货币使用不同的区块时间(生成一个新区块所需的时间),如比特币约为10分钟,而以太坊为15秒。

            3. 矿工竞争:矿工挖掘新区块的竞争程度也会影响交易确认的速度。当挖矿难度增加,新的交易需要等待的时间也会增长。

            3. 加密货币如何应对监管问题?

            随着加密货币的普及,监管问题逐渐成为各国政府关注的焦点,涉及资金洗钱、防欺诈、用户保护等方面。

            1. 合规交易所:许多加密货币交易所不断努力遵循当地法律法规,保证合规运营,为用户提供透明和安全的交易环境。

            2. KYC与AML政策:为了防止洗钱行为,很多交易所要求用户进行实名注册(KYC),并实施反洗钱(AML)政策,以确保合法性。

            3. 法律框架:一些国家和地区相继出台法律法规,明确加密货币的法律地位,为其发展提供指导与保障。

            4. 为什么选择使用加密货币进行交易?

            尽管加密货币交易具备一定风险及不确定性,但其相较于传统金融交易方式,依然有着独特优势。

            1. 全球性:加密货币可以跨越国界,实现无阻碍交易,无需中介机构,降低交易成本。

            2. 隐私保护:许多加密货币提供交易隐私,用户可以在不公开个人信息的前提下完成交易,保护用户隐私。

            3. 透明性:加密货币交易通过区块链公开记录,任何人都可以查阅交易历史,确保交易的透明性。

            4. 安全性:通过密码学技术,用户的资金安全性大大提升,资金不可篡改,减少了欺诈风险。

            总之,加密货币密码的计算、交易机制和安全保护策略相辅相成,共同构建了一个安全、透明且高效的交易环境。深入理解这些方面,不仅有助于用户更好地保护自身资产,还能助力行业的健康发展。

            分享 :
                  author

                  tpwallet

                  T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                          
                              

                          相关新闻

                          思考一个适合的MID加密货
                          2024-08-31
                          思考一个适合的MID加密货

                          ---### MID加密货币概述 MID加密货币作为一种新兴的数字资产,在区块链技术的支持下,迅速成为投资者关注的焦点。它...

                          如何识别与防范加密货币
                          2024-08-31
                          如何识别与防范加密货币

                          在数字货币快速发展的今天,加密货币不仅为很多投资者带来了可观的收益,同时也伴随着日益严重的诈骗问题。由...

                          如何选择与销售加密货币
                          2024-09-01
                          如何选择与销售加密货币

                          加密货币矿机概述 在数字货币领域,加密货币矿机是实现挖矿的核心设备。挖矿不仅仅是获取加密货币的方式,它还...

                          如何在俄罗斯合法安全地
                          2024-09-02
                          如何在俄罗斯合法安全地

                          随着全球数字货币的迅速发展,加密货币在投资和交易市场中越来越占据重要的地位。尤其是在俄罗斯,加密货币的...